The latest LFP 3.2V 314Ah battery cells are redefining energy storage solutions for industrial, commercial, and renewable energy applications. Designed with lithium iron phosphate (LFP) chemistry, these cells combine high safety, long cycle life, and reliable performance for modern Battery Energy Storage Systems (BESS).
Key Specifications and Features:
Model: LFP 3.2V 314Ah (Lithium Iron Phosphate)
Nominal Voltage: 3.2 V
Capacity: 314 Ah
Nominal Energy: ≈ 1005 Wh per cell
Max Charge Current: 0.5C (~157 A)
Max Discharge Current: 1C – 2C (314 – 628 A)
Internal Resistance: 0.5 – 1 mΩ
Weight: ~11.5 kg
Cycle Life: 6000 cycles @ 80% Depth of Discharge (DoD)
Form Factor: Cylindrical or prismatic, per manufacturer specifications
C-Rate: 0.5C
Advantages of LFP 3.2V 314Ah Cells:
High Safety: LFP chemistry is inherently stable and thermally safe.
Long Lifespan: Up to 6000 cycles ensures years of reliable energy storage.
High Power Capability: Supports high charge/discharge currents for grid-scale or industrial applications.
Energy Density: Approx. 87 Wh/kg, providing compact and efficient storage solutions.
Versatile Form Factor: Suitable for various BESS designs, from modular racks to containerized systems.
